Solar-powered water pumps for irrigation:
In the world of agriculture, water is a precious resource. Without proper irrigation, crops can wither and die, leading to devastating consequences for farmers and communities alike. However, traditional methods of irrigation can be costly and often rely on non-renewable energy sources. That’s where solar-powered water pumps come in.
Solar-powered water pumps harness the power of the sun to pump water from a source such as a well or pond to irrigate fields. These systems consist of solar panels that convert sunlight into electricity, which then powers the pump. This innovative technology offers several advantages over conventional irrigation methods.
Firstly, solar-powered water pumps are environmentally friendly. They produce zero greenhouse gas emissions during operation since they use clean energy from the sun. This not only reduces carbon footprints but also helps combat climate change by decreasing reliance on fossil fuels.
Secondly, these systems are cost-effective in the long run. While initial installation costs may be higher than traditional pumps, there are no ongoing fuel expenses since sunlight is free. Additionally, maintenance costs are minimal compared to diesel or electric pumps.
Furthermore, solar-powered water pumps provide flexibility and independence to farmers in remote areas without access to grid electricity or unreliable power supply. These systems allow them to irrigate their crops efficiently without being dependent on external factors beyond their control.
Moreover, these sustainable solutions contribute to food security by ensuring consistent crop yields even during droughts or periods of limited rainfall. With reliable access to irrigation through solar power, farmers can grow a wider variety of crops throughout the year and increase their overall productivity.
Solar-powered electric fences for livestock management:
Livestock owners face numerous challenges when it comes to managing their animals’ movements while keeping them safe from predators or potential hazards outside designated areas. Solar-powered electric fences offer an efficient solution that combines renewable energy with effective animal containment.
Traditional electric fences rely on grid electricity or batteries for power supply which can be costly and environmentally unfriendly. Solar-powered electric fences, on the other hand, utilize solar panels to convert sunlight into electricity, eliminating the need for grid connection or regular battery replacements.
These fences work by delivering a harmless but memorable electric shock when touched by an animal. The shock creates an aversive association that trains livestock to respect their boundaries, preventing them from straying into dangerous areas or wandering off.
The benefits of solar-powered electric fences are numerous. Firstly, they provide a cost-effective solution by reducing energy costs associated with traditional fencing systems. Since sunlight is free and abundant in most rural areas, harnessing solar power can significantly decrease operational expenses over time.
Additionally, these fences are easy to install and maintain. With no need for complex wiring or ongoing battery monitoring, farmers can save both time and effort while ensuring reliable livestock management.
Furthermore, solar-powered electric fences promote sustainability in agriculture by reducing reliance on non-renewable energy sources. By utilizing clean energy from the sun instead of conventional electricity or batteries that require regular replacement and disposal, farmers can have a positive impact on the environment.
Moreover, these fences enhance animal welfare as they provide safe boundaries for livestock without causing any harm beyond temporary discomfort caused by the electric shock. Animals quickly learn to avoid contact with the fence after one or two experiences and will remain within their designated area without physical barriers like barbed wire or wooden fences that may cause injury.
